| US 7,480,309 B1 | ||
| Port aggregation load balancing | ||
| Gregory L. DeJager, San Jose, Calif. (US); James R. Rivers, Saratoga, Calif. (US); David H. Yen, Palo Alto, Calif. (US); Stewart Findlater, Mountain View, Calif. (US); and Scott A. Emery, Saratoga, Calif. (US) | ||
| Assigned to Cisco Technology, Inc., San Jose, Calif. (US) | ||
| Filed on Mar. 07, 2005, as Appl. No. 11/75,436. | ||
| Application 11/075436 is a continuation of application No. 10/683222, filed on Oct. 10, 2003, granted, now 6,934,293. | ||
| Application 10/683222 is a continuation of application No. 10/251605, filed on Sep. 19, 2002, granted, now 6,667,975. | ||
| Application 10/251605 is a continuation of application No. 09/204658, filed on Dec. 02, 1998, granted, now 6,473,424. | ||
| This patent is subject to a terminal disclaimer. | ||
| Int. Cl. H04L 12/56 (2006.01); H04L 12/28 (2006.01) | ||
| U.S. Cl. 370—412 [370/389; 370/392; 718/103; 718/105] | 13 Claims |

| 1. A packet forwarding device comprising:
a port group; and
a network traffic distribution system configured to
determine a stream ID for a packet and assign the packet having the stream ID to a queue of a port of the port group, and
adjust a queue assignment of a subsequent packet having the stream ID to a queue of a different port of the port group based
on load in the queues of the ports of the group.
|